About
A casual beachfront spot right on Playa Samara, where the draw is dining at sunset over the Pacific with the waves and, many evenings, live music. Seafood leads the menu, with jumbo shrimp in coconut sauce, arroz con camarones and the Filet de Pescado al Ancla, at moderate prices. Servers like Victor get named for friendly help.

Beautiful spot right on the beach. We walked in off the beach and scored a lovely table right in front of the beach. Got in on happy hour , which was nice. I had the shrimp with coconut sauce and vegetables- excellent, jumbo juicy shrimp! My husband had the chicken cordon blu, with rice- equally as yummy and both big portions. Víctor our waiter was great, friendly and quick on service, and recommendations. Definitely a great place to eat and watch the gorgeous sky from the sunset under a tree canopy. Only Downside was parking was hard to find- but hey- Pura Vida!- In paradise, no rush and eventually found a place to park:)

April 2025 update: My wife and I visited this casual, beachfront restaurant a dozen times during our our recent two-week stay in Samara - some with our son, daughter-in-law, and two grandchildren; others, as a couple. During meals, the six of us enjoyed a variety of moderately priced menu offerings; my wife’s and my mutual favorite entree is the Filet de Pescado al Ancla. Ancla’s yummy smoothies were our afternoon refreshment several times. Dining at sunset is a delight, watching the changing sky colors over the ocean. We were treated several times - afternoon and evening -to wonderful live music performances. Each time, our experiences were enhanced by the friendly service provided to us by Kady, Rebecca, Kay, Victor and several others. +++++++++++++ December 2024: During our two-week stay in Samara last month, my wife and I dined at El Ancla four times. Our food and beverages were good (one of my wife’s entrees was not satisfactory initially, and, when we informed our server, he returned it to the kitchen and brought her a replacement, which pleased her) and priced moderately; we enjoyed the beachside setting, listening to the waves and watching lovely sunsets; and, one evening, we were treated to wonderful live music, played by two talented musicians. The servers were friendly and helpful - we wished only that there were more of them: they were responsible for many tables, which are set in a large area and some distance from the kitchen and bar; several times, when we wanted their assistance, we were not able to catch the attention of any of them for quite a while. Nevertheless, we are looking forward to more dinners at El Ancla, when we visit Samara again.
